Dual Diagnosis Treatment

A dual diagnosis presents a complex challenge, requiring holistic treatment approaches that simultaneously both addiction and underlying mental health conditions. It's crucial to recognize that these two issues often influence each other, creating a vicious cycle. Effective dual diagnosis treatment targets improving overall well-being by utilizing therapies tailored to each individual's needs. Options may involve a variety of approaches, such as individual therapy, group therapy, medication management.

< Pathways to Wellness: Effective Drug Addiction Treatment Options

There's a multitude of pathways toward wellness when confronting drug addiction. Successful treatment programs cater to individual needs, providing comprehensive support and fostering lasting transformation.

It's crucial to recognize that addiction is a complex condition requiring personalized approaches. Counseling offer invaluable emotional support and coping mechanisms, helping individuals understand the underlying triggers contributing to their struggles.

Medication-assisted treatment can play a vital role in managing withdrawal symptoms and reducing cravings. Medicinal interventions, when combined with behavioral therapies, can significantly improve the recovery process.

Moreover, outpatient programs provide structured environments conducive to healing and growth, allowing individuals to dedicate themselves to their recovery journey.

It's essential to remember that recovery is a continuous journey. Continued support remains crucial for long-term success, empowering individuals to navigate life's challenges and maintain lasting sobriety.
